Transaction 3e0523584e15991197324bc3c8b24bcf62f31aff3ff679422a37ad34d3f017ee

1 Input
2 Outputs
  • 3e0523584e15991197324bc3c8b24bcf62f31aff3ff679422a37ad34d3f017ee:0
  • value  7138887
    address  34AioVKQMekQjXnygPPWpzGWoBtCAVocmR
  • 3e0523584e15991197324bc3c8b24bcf62f31aff3ff679422a37ad34d3f017ee:1
  • value  353070
    address  bc1q20cvvqnsmpqszzqttlw9cyhdhux39ln3k7fqyh